Overall Meaning

Howlin' Wolf's song "Built for Comfort" is a song about self-acceptance and confidence. In the first verse, the lyrics address the different body types that exist, some are built one way, and some are built another way, and Wolf acknowledges that he is built for comfort and not for speed. He then warns not to call him fat, as he is content with his body type. The second verse begins with the recognition that some people move quickly and others believe in signs, but Wolf encourages his potential lover to take their time with him. He repeats the chorus, indicating that he has everything all good girls need. The final verse admits that Wolf does not have material things such as diamonds or gold, but he has love and the ability to satisfy a woman's soul.


Overall, the song's message is that everyone is different and built differently, but that does not mean they are any less worthy of love and affection. Wolf embraces his body type, even though it may not conform to societal beauty standards, and values human connection and love over material possessions. The song's themes empower listeners to accept and appreciate themselves for who they are, regardless of how they look.
